How the Monterey Bay Aquarium enhanced collaboration while doubling their education programs

Monterey Bay Aquarium, a leader in ocean conservation education that serves about 110,000 students, teachers, and chaperones annually, was expanding its school, teen, and teacher programs and building a new education center to meet demand. As programs doubled, staff juggled multiple projects using Excel spreadsheets, which led to missed tasks, time-consuming updates, and a need for a collaboration tool flexible enough for curriculum and event workflows rather than product development.

By adopting Wrike, the aquarium centralized project visibility, documented expectations up front, and automated scheduling with task dependencies, so date changes cascade automatically. The team regained hours previously spent on spreadsheets (reassigning a departed staffer’s tasks went from four hours to 30 seconds), reduced administrative work, improved cross-team support, and is now scaling education programs more efficiently.
